Nars Sheer Glow Foundation in Mont Blanc

I purchased and reviewed this foundation nearly a year ago. (Original review is here) Here’s what it says on the Nars website about Sheer Glow:

A glowing, natural radiant finish foundation with sheer and buildable coverage that immaculately evens skin tone. Replete with skincare benefits and the NARS Complexion Brightening Formula, it leaves skin hydrated, more luminous, softer and smoother. Used daily, Sheer Glow Foundation improves the skin’s brightness and texture.

Project Pan 12 - Nars Sheer Glow

When the Project Pan first started, the weather was still summery, so I didn’t get much use from this foundation. But now that the weather is starting to cool down, I’ve been able to wear it a few times each week. I’m not yet winter pale, so I’ve been mixing in a little bit of my IT Cosmetics CC+ Cream in shade Light to make it work. I’ve also been mixing in a few drops of the Nyx Born to Glow Liquid Illuminator. Despite using this foundation several times over the past few weeks, it looks as if I haven’t made a dent in using it up!

This foundation works well for my skin and it doesn’t make my skin feel like it is suffocating.  The coverage is sheer but buildable. My complaint from the original review still stands – why doesn’t this foundation come with a pump? It boggles my mind that you have to buy the pump separately, and most places don’t even sell the pump!
